Episode 264: What the Skin Remembers

“Today’s episode explores a trans femme perspective on beauty, self-care, and ancestral nourishment, contrasting it with modern consumerist beauty standards. The author of the source article, Dr. Jaime Hoerricks, argues that true femme embodiment and softness stem not from external products or performative “glow-ups,” but from internal healing, natural remedies, and a connection to ancestral practices. They emphasise the idea of refusal—a rejection of beauty culture's demands to correct or conceal, advocating instead for a sacred and holistic approach to the body and adornment that prioritises wholeness, memory, and authenticity over societal validation.”
